Fungal Studios has officially released a playable demo for its latest project, Linerunner, a minimalist racing game that emphasizes time trials and precision driving. As first reported by Store, this title promises players a unique racing experience, where every turn is mathematically optimized for perfect handling and speed.
Linerunner’s design focuses on simplicity, allowing players to engage deeply with the core mechanics of racing. The gameplay revolves around navigating through intricately designed levels where the objective is to complete races as quickly as possible. Each course features medals that players can earn by achieving specific times, adding an element of competition not just against the clock but also against friends and the global leaderboard.
One of the standout features of Linerunner lies in its innovative control scheme. Players need to master a single long and smooth button press to maneuver their runner effectively. This straightforward mechanic allows for a focus on timing and precision rather than complex button combinations, making the game accessible to newcomers while still challenging for seasoned players. The design philosophy behind this control scheme is to eliminate distractions and enable players to concentrate solely on their racing performance.
The demo currently available on Steam includes two maps that showcase the game’s unique mechanics.
